Originally posted by: AIWGuru
Originally posted by: PorBleemo
I wonder if the lower end NV40 cards will have the encoder also. It's starting to look to me that nVidia might win this round.

-Por

The video encoder is not a fixed function unit. It's just drivers taking advantage of fully programmable PS 3.0 shaders. As long as the lower end NV4x cards support PS 3.0, there's no technical limitation why they shouldn't support video encoding.

Nvidia's Video encoder doesn't use the shader pipeline (although they CAN use it if they desire) ATI's current solution uses the shader pipeline, but NVidia chose to use a seperate programmable video processor. The codecs will be coded into the processor and the dx calls will be intercepted by the processor. As far as I've seen, none of this is working except perhaps MPEG-2 decoding. I'm now hearing that the decoding will be transparent, but the encoding will require special software, and that Adobe is readying a special version of After affects. I'm not liking the sound of that as it seems to indicate hardware acceleration for real-time preview, not hardware encoding of your video files. Looks like its capablilities are wait and see.
